Inno setup 使用inno发布VB.net程序时不显示桌面图标

Inno setup 使用inno发布VB.net程序时不显示桌面图标,inno-setup,Inno Setup,要更改什么以使这部分代码在桌面上显示图标 [Icons] Name: "{group}\{#MyAppName}"; Filename: "{app}\{#MyAppExeName}" Name: "{commondesktop}\{#MyAppName}"; Filename: "{app}\{#MyAppExeName}"; Tasks: desktopicon [Run] Filename: "{app}\{#MyAppExeName}"; Description: "{cm:Launc

要更改什么以使这部分代码在桌面上显示图标

[Icons]
Name: "{group}\{#MyAppName}"; Filename: "{app}\{#MyAppExeName}"
Name: "{commondesktop}\{#MyAppName}"; Filename: "{app}\{#MyAppExeName}"; Tasks: desktopicon

[Run]
Filename: "{app}\{#MyAppExeName}"; Description: "{cm:LaunchProgram,{#StringChange(MyAppName, '&', '&&')}}"; Flags: nowait postinstall skipifsilent

图标将在选择desktopicon任务时创建。测试时是否满足此标准?我在哪里以及如何选择桌面图标?脚本中有[Tasks]部分,也可能有[Components]部分。这是有答案的。您可以将任务连接到特定组件,也可以将其作为独立任务复选框。或者,如果您希望始终不只是有条件地创建该图标,请删除第二个[Icons]条目的Tasks:desktopicon tail。